Sr.net Developer Resume
SUMMARY
- Microsoft® Certified .NET Developer with around 8 years of experience in software development; Analyzing, Designing, Developing, Implementing and Maintaining 2 Tier to N - Tier applications.
- Extensive work experience using .Net Core, .Net Standard, ASP.net MVC, ASP.net Web API, WebForms, C#, AJAX, WCF, LINQ, NUnit, TypeScript, ReactJS, Angular, JSON, XML, HTML, CSS, Bootstrap, SQL Server, Microservices, T-SQL, Entity framework, SSIS, SSRS and Azure.
- Experience in Azure services like Application Insights, App services, Storage, SQL Server, Service bus, even hub, Logic Apps etc.
- Hands-on experience in developing UI using Web Forms, HTML, CSS, MVC Razor, Angular and ReactJs.
- Work experience in SOA architecture using WCF, ASP.Net Web API and ASP.Net Web API core.
- Experience in migrating monolithic applications to microservices
- Solid work experience in Analysis, Design, Development, Maintenance and Implementation of various client-server applications working in various roles in fast pace.
- Experience in software development life cycle (SDLC) methodologies.
- Extensive experience in preparing the business requirement, technical, functional specification and traceability matrix documents.
- Experience in designing database, writing queries, stored procedures, functions, triggers, creating indexes performance tuning using MSSQL server.
- Expert knowledge in best practices; Object Oriented Programming (OOPs), S.O.L.I.D design principles and Gang of Four (GoF) design patterns.
- Fast learner; able to approach innovative ideas for the upcoming generation applications.
- Extensive customer interaction, interpersonal and team management skills.
- Self-starter with the ability to set the direction with little or no oversight.
- Worked as Onsite coordinator to communicate between Onsite and offshore development team to ensure on time deliverables.
- Ability to Train and guide the subordinates.
TECHNICAL SKILLS
Cloud Technologies: Microsoft Azure
Programming/Scripting: C, Javascript, C#, VB. NET, ASP.NET, .NET Core, MVC, MVVM, LINQ, Python, Bash Shell Scripting, Power shell.
UI/UX Skills: HTML, CSS, Angular JS, Angular 2, Angular 4, Angular 7, Typescript, React.
Database skills: Microsoft SQL Server 2019, 2017, 2014, 2012, My SQL, PL/SQL, Oracle Database
Software: Visual Studio 2019, 2017, 2015 & 2013, SSMS,SSIS, SAP Crystal Reports, SSRS, Pycharm, Jupyter, MSOffice (Including MS Project, Visio, Excel), Oracle SQL developer, POSTMAN, Fiddler.
Version Control: TFS, Azure Repos, Tortoise SVN, GIT
ERP Skills: SAP Systems Configuration, End to End Business Processes in SAP
Operating Systems: Windows 10/8.1/7/XP/2000/9x, Linux, UNIX, MAC
Hardware: Assembling of PC, Networking & Troubleshooting
PROFESSIONAL EXPERIENCE
Confidential
Sr.Net Developer
Responsibilities:
- Actively worked on Pennsylvania (PA) Elections applications with continuous Development, Support, and Maintenance.
- Developed Screens, modules, events, classes, and functionalities on C#, vb.Net, ASP.NET MVC,Entity Framework Core, .Net Core, Blazor, Angular 7 and React based applications to meet the client requirements as per the Business Rules.
- Responsible for Designing and Developing the Reusable UI Components like Dashboard and Partial Views in ASP.NET.
- Worked on WCF, RESTful and SOAP web Services and sending messages over Http protocol using JSON/XML format for data interchange across the systems.
- Extensively used joins, sub-queries, Cursors, Loops, CTEs for complex queries in SQL which were involving multiple tables from different databases using linked servers.
- Extensively worked on indexes, SQL Performance tunings using Table scan, Index scan, SQL Server Profiler and execution plan.
- Created & scheduled jobs in SQL Server and executed SSIS packages which were developed to update database objects daily and maintained nightly loads of data.
- Designed new reports in SSRS linking to stored procedures in databases and dynamically fetching the data.
- Designed reports with complex sub reports, Drill down, Cross Tabs, formulas, functions, parameters in SAP Crystal Reports.
- Created and configured HTTP Triggers in the Azure Functions with Application Insights for monitoring and performing load testing on the Applications using VSTS.
- Architectured and implemented ETL and data movement solutions using Azure Data Factory, SSIS.
- Recreating existing application logic and functionality in the Azure Data Lake, Data Factory, SQL Database and SQL datawarehouse environment.
- Used Azure Service Bus queues and web jobs to pass messages between different rest web API in order to decouple them to ensure scalability.
Environment: C#, Vb.Net, ASP.NET, MVC, LINQ, HTML5, CSS, Bootstrap, JavaScript, Blazor, AJAX, JQuery, Entity Framework, Visual Studio, Microsoft Azure, Microsoft SQL Server, SSIS, TFS, Angular 7, React JS, REST, SOAP, Web API, WCF, WPF.
Confidential, PA
Sr.Net Developer
Responsibilities:
- Developed and supported Resource Management System (RMS) for Berks County, PA, and Special Needs Registry (SNR)/ Functional Needs Registry (FNR) applications on C#, Entity Framework, MVVM, MVC using Razor, Angular 7, and LINQ for states of DE, FL, GA, NJ, NY, OH and cities of New Orleans LA, St. Louis MO and Fort bend TX.
- Used ASP.Net Core MVC for developing application versions by using Razor View Engine and helper methods.
- Made use of REST services written in WCF to supply data in JSON format to flash components in showing bar, pie, line charts in the application.
- Developed and consumed WCF Services, used AJAX calls to fetch data to the front end.
- Designed and implemented the application using MicroService Architecture for its various distinct advantages like loose coupling and design patterns.
- Developed database relationships, tables, schemas, views, and synonyms.
- Actively deployed the code to the servers and managed sites using Internet Information Services (IIS) and Microsoft Azure Service.
- Worked on SSIS to Import and Export Data from Tables in DataBase.
- Worked on APIs of many applications such as Microsoft Team Foundation Server (TFS) API, GraphQL, Teamwork Inc API and Kofax KTA.
- Developed the code for POST/GET calls to the APIs of the applications and to perform desired functions.
- Designed complex reports in SAP Crystal Server using custom formulas, invoices creation and communicated progress to Project Manager.
- Worked on Postman, Swagger, and Fiddler tools.
- Migrated SQL 2012 Databases on Cloud using SQL Server Azure.
- Worked on the Redis Cache storage mechanism to provide the Server-side caching.
- Implemented Azure Storage (Storage accounts, blob storage, managed and unmanaged storages), Azure SQL Azure Services, and developed Azure Web role.
- Worked on Azure Application Insights to store user activities and error logging.
- Performed Azure DevOps admin role for all the projects and deployed code to various environments using both manual and automated deployments in TFS and SQL Server.
Environment: C#, Vb.Net, ASP.NET, MVC, LINQ, HTML5, CSS, Bootstrap, JavaScript, AJAX, JQuery, Entity Framework, Visual Studio, Microsoft Azure, Microsoft SQL Server, SSIS, SAP Crystal Reports, TFS, Angular 7, React